The blockage will not unclear itself. Did he remove the plate heat exchanger as that would usually be the blocked part.
I would clear it easily but it is a bit messy and time consuming so I usually charge about £136. Very few engineers will bother though.
What I don't think that you should do is get that engineer to fit a new boiler ! Why should he bother to repair it ( even if he knew how ) if you will then pay him £2000 to fit a new boiler.
You should get three quotations for the same boiler. The warranty length will depend on the relationship he has with Worcester. Mad I know but if you pretty much only fit their boilers they give a longer warranty.
Whilst they think it will get installers to fit more of their boilers, they forget that others like me are uncompetitive to quote for fitting Worcester boilers in respect of the warranty length.
